# Generate job
php artisan make:job ProcessPayment
# Generate job with queueable
php artisan make:job SendEmail --queued
// app/Jobs/SendWelcomeEmail.php
namespace App\Jobs;
use App\Mail\WelcomeEmail;
use App\Models\User;
use Illuminate\Bus\Queueable;
use Illuminate\Contracts\Queue\ShouldQueue;
use Illuminate\Foundation\Bus\Dispatchable;
use Illuminate\Queue\InteractsWithQueue;
use Illuminate\Queue\SerializesModels;
use Illuminate\Support\Facades\Mail;
class SendWelcomeEmail implements ShouldQueue
{
use Dispatchable, InteractsWithQueue, Queueable, SerializesModels;
public int $tries = 3;
public int $timeout = 30;
public function __construct(
public User $user
) {}
public function handle(): void
{
Mail::to($this->user)->send(new WelcomeEmail($this->user));
}
public function failed(\Throwable $exception): void
{
\Log::error('Failed to send welcome email', [
'user_id' => $this->user->id,
'error' => $exception->getMessage(),
]);
}
}
// Dispatch immediately
SendWelcomeEmail::dispatch($user);
// Dispatch with delay
SendWelcomeEmail::dispatch($user)->delay(now()->addMinutes(5));
// Dispatch at specific time
ProcessPayment::dispatch($payment)->delay(now()->addHours(2));
// Chain jobs
Bus::chain([
new ProcessOrder($order),
new SendConfirmationEmail($user),
new UpdateInventory($order),
])->dispatch();
// Batch jobs
Bus::batch([
new ProcessVideo($video1),
new ProcessVideo($video2),
])->then(function (Batch $batch) {
// All completed
})->catch(function (Batch $batch, \Throwable $e) {
// First failure
})->name('Process Videos')->dispatch();
